The S11059-01WT is a color sensor that supports the I2C (inter-integrated circuit) interface. It is sensitive to red (λ=615nm), green (λ=530 nm), blue (λ=460 nm), and infrared (λ=855 nm) light, and outputs detected results as 16-bit digital data for each color. The photodiode for each color is automatically switched sequentially to perform measurements. The sensitivity and integration time can be adjusted so that light measurements can be performed over a wide range.
FEATUREs
I2C interface compatible
Sequential measurements of red, green, blue, and infrared light
2-step sensitivity switching (sensitivity ratio 1 : 10)
Sensitivity adjustment by setting the integration time
Low voltage (2.5 V or 3.3 V) operation
Low current consumption: 75 μA typ.
Small package (WL-CSP: wafer level-chip size package)
Internal infrared-cut filter
Wide dynamic range (Low gain: 1 to 10 klx)
APPLICATIONs
LCD backlight adjustment for cell phones, notebook PC, etc.
Energy-saving sensor for large-size TV, etc.
Various types of light detection or color adjustment
